  • James Hardy Ropes (September 3, 1866 – January 7, 1933) was an American theologian.
  • He graduated from Harvard College in 1889 and was an instructor there from 1895 to 1898 and an assistant professor until 1903.
  • Ropes was then appointed the Bussey Professor of New Testament criticism.
  • He occupied the Hollis Chair at Harvard Divinity School starting in 1910.
